Use Matched Breath To Gather Attention
- Use a matched, slow breath to collect attention and bring relaxed focus to bodily sensation.
- Tara Brach guides counting to six in and six out, then feeling the breath's sensations to stabilize presence.
Scan Inside Out To Feel Aliveness
- Scan gently through the body from brow to hands, softening and sensing sensations from the inside out.
- Tara instructs relaxing the eyes, tongue, shoulders, and feeling tingling and vibrating energy as a field of aliveness.
Sensation Arises In Interior Space
- Sensations appear within an interior space of openness, like particles emerging in emptiness, linking aliveness to spaciousness.
- Tara invites imagining the nucleus of an atom to sense the empty space that gives rise to sensations in chest, belly, pelvis.
